    According to Amway’s income disclosure an individual distributor with a pin level of Platinum could make an annual income of: $18,064 if they keep a sales volume of 7,500 Point Value or about $22,500 in a month to month basis. Now, try to sell $22,500 worth of vitamins, shampoos, other personal care or consumable items . You would need at least 150 customers buying at least $150 worth of products month to month to keep that volume. If you are able to do so, you could be making an average of $1,500 a month, which translate to about $9.40 per hour if you do this full time 40 hours a week. That doesn’t include overhead cost such as: monthly membership subscription, fuel if you have to deliver any products to customers or costs to any type of anual events, if attending. By now you could realize the chances of actually making money are very slim, unless you recruit other individual distributors. They will ultimately be your “customers” even if they think they are now business owners.
